a renaissance man and a faithful friend

William F. Buckley, Jr. was a man of intellectual brilliance, entertaining wit and personal charm, and an amazing vocabulary.  but he will always be remembered first as the founder of the modern American conservative movement. he conceived it, nurtured it, grew it, and, when needed, skewered it.  today the conservative movement in America is broad, strong, and vibrant—we all owe so much to the great man who began and guided it for so long.



"I am, I fully grant, a phenomenon, but not because of any speed in composition," he wrote in The New York Times Book Review in 1986. "I asked myself the other day, `Who else, on so many issues, has been so right so much of the time?' I couldn't think of anyone."

he will be sorely missed.

William F. Buckley, Jr.   1925-2008
